FOIA Data Analyst

CACI International Inc is seeking a FOIA Data Analyst to support a government customer by analyzing and monitoring systems for PII and identifying privacy gaps. The role involves applying advanced analytical skills to provide data-driven insights and support incident response strategies.

Responsibilities

Analyzing large datasets to identify potential privacy breaches and detect anomalies in data access patterns
Collaborating with incident response team members and cross functional teams to investigate and respond to privacy breach incidents
Conducting data analysis and providing recommendations to inform incident response strategies
Developing and maintaining data visualizations and reports to communicate metrics and trends to stakeholders
Informing team on emerging threats, technologies, and developing trends in data privacy management

Required

Active Clearance: TS/SCI with Poly
Bachelor's degree and 3-5 years of experience in computer science, data science or related field
Strong programming skills in languages that can support rapid data analysis such as Python or SQL
Strong data analysis and problem-solving skills, with the ability to communicate compl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ders
Experience working with large datasets and data management systems, such as relational databases or NoSQL databases
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and respond to situations with urgency and accuracy

Preferred

Master's degree in Cybersecurity Risk Management, Computer Science, or related field and two years of experience
Experience working in a cloud-based environment, such as AWS or other relevant systems
Experience reviewing server logs and using analytical tools, including AI, to detect incidents
Certification in Incident Response such as the EC-Council Certified Incident Handler (ECIH), Global Information Assurance Certification (GIAC) Certified Incident Handler (GCIH), or equivalent
Experience in formal modeling, and computational and social science
